Wow, I did that a year ago, and ended up landing at ezezine.com that place you are leaving. There are some other services worth checking. My findings were that most are blacklisted.

The problem seems to be that most services let spammers and marketers
bring in old shabby lists and ruin their blacklist status.

I am staying with ezezine.com as they seem to be the only ones that care.
